To marry someone you often have to complete their little quests, the wikis have a good breakdown of who you can marry. My reccomendation would be the Atmer that owns the clothing shop in solitude because you'll get a cut of the store's profits, she's the only atmer you can marry and you can keep her in her house in solitude
I suppose the other choice would be to find someone in Morthal or Falkreath and choose to live with them, that way you'd get a house in those towns by proxy.
